    Merge Rules In Templates

    Hi Guys,

    Quick question: can we use the merge rules on a template entry, or has the v3.1 update broken the merge rules?

    Reason I ask is that I've got a (rather long) template from the CoreRPG which I need to modify by changing a single line, so I've used merge="join", but all of the other attributes of the parent template are now nolonger avaliable - including all the <anchored> settings.

    The merge attribute is not supported on templates.

    You can either redefine the template, or create another template to inherit from that one (but then you have to change the sheetdata references, if they're not all your own).

    Does "mergerule" still work/is supported on templates? The Ruleset Modification Guide says:

    "Simply merging is not sufficient for some uses in templates. Therefore, any tag in a template may contain a "mergerule" attribute taking one of the following values."

    Yes, the merge attribute and mergerule attribute do work on the data within templates, just not on the template definitions themselves.
